Area = 0.5 x base x height Perimeter = side 1 + side 2 + side 3 Formula for Area of a triangle is A = bh/2, where A is Area, b is base, and h is heigth. Formula for finding the perimeter is P = s1 + s2 + s3, where s represent side, or P = AB + BC + AC where the letters represent the sides.

The area of a Parallelogram is Base * Height The Perimeter is 2(side1 + side2)
The area of any triangle is1/2 of (the length of the triangle's base) times (the triangle's height).
